How does work?

Depending on what you’re searching for, offers therapy for people, households, or couples. You produce an account and submit a questionnaire to find the ideal match.

During the questionnaire, you have the ability to list out your therapist choices, including their gender, religious beliefs, age, sexual preference, language, in addition to what concerns you’re intending to deal with, and how important it is that your therapist be well versed in those topics.

It can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days to be matched to an in-state counselor.

According to, counselors are certified, trained, experienced, and certified psychologists, marital relationship and family therapists, medical social workers, or licensed professional counselors.

All the business’s counselors have a master’s or doctorate degree and have a minimum of 3 years and 2,000 hours of experience as mental health specialists.

You can merely email to be reassigned if you don’t like who you’re combined with.

Once you have actually been matched with a therapist, you can instantly begin messaging them in a secure and private chatroom.

The chatroom is accessible at any time as long as your device has trusted internet. Messaging isn’t done in real-time, so there’s no guaranteed reaction time from your therapist. As a result, you’re complimentary to message your therapist at any hour of the day.

Your therapist will reply with questions, guidance, homework, or feedback, and the app will alert you of their action.

The conversations are saved in the chatroom so you’re totally free to go over and reflect whenever you ‘d like. Every discussion is also safeguarded by rigorous federal and state HIPAA laws.

Faced with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ham went with online counselling instead.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was encouraged and ready to handle my problems and rather liked the idea of doing so in the comfort of my own home,” said the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he found a therapist whose profile fit his requirements and reserved a chat session for the next day.

The physician app Babylon uses ther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with a lot of in the US.

 

Online training encourages therapists on whatever from using emojis to preventing misconceptions. They likewise need to secure patients’ individual information– an issue that has actually caused controversy in the US, where huge online treatment platforms have come under the spotlight.

Buckley said patients need to examine services’ personal privacy policies before signing up. “Not all online counselling sites utilize professionally trained therapists or comply with an ethics polic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the very first circumstances. As with all type of services and support, what works for one person might not work for another person,” he said.

Marc Bush, chief policy consultant at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t replace face-to-face therapy with a trained specialist. If a young person is struggling, we would motivate them to talk with their GP in the first instance, or to call a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has generalised an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the best f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to actually get a sense of the problems I was handling,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I realised after that online session how important social interaction was.
